Brief Biography


Ioannis Kordonis received both his Diploma in Electrical and Computer Engineering and his Ph.D. degree from the National Technical University of Athens, Greece, in 2009 and 2015 respectively. During 2016-2017 he was a post-doctoral researcher at the University of Southern California, and during 2018-2019 he held postdoctoral and ATER positions at CentraleSupelec, on the Rennes campus, in the Automatic Control Group - IETR. He is currently a postdoctoral researcher at the Intelligent Robotics and Automation Lab of the National Technical University of Athens. His research interests include Game Theory, Stochastic Control theory, and Machine Learning. He is also interested in applications in the areas of Energy - Power Systems, Transportation Systems, and Bioengineering.
